Transaction e03c62b85e65175b8590628aed9c66ebe083d97334322f256d1e1a56c359a95d

block
41e1de2cb96e5c333d0a81fb28029f7247de96f12213500bbe48f7c9f9055807

5 Inputs

2 Outputs